Subj : read json from file To : Mortifis From : echicken Date : Sat Jun 20 2020 04:16 pm Re: read json from file By: Mortifis to All on Sat Jun 20 2020 11:24:37 Mo> I have a local json file that I'd like to search for a matching unknown record Mo> # without having to read in the entire object (the file has over 200,00 records If your file looks like this: {"a":0,"b":1,"c":2,"d":3} You basically need to parse the whole thing. Or write your own special parser. If your file is like this: {"a":0,"b":1,"c":2,"d":3} {"e":4,"f":5,"g":6,"h":7} Then those are two separate JSON strings on adjacent lines. In which case you can read the file line by line, and each line will work with JSON.parse. --- echicken electronic chicken bbs - bbs.electronicchicken.com þ Synchronet þ electronic chicken bbs - bbs.electronicchicken.com .
